  2. #Debian #APT3.0 Stable Released With New Package Solver & Refined Text UI
    This stable release brings forward the new package solver and very prominent for Linux command-line users is the new UI with colors, columnar displays, and other improvements. I've been loving the refined text user interface of APT 2.9 releases and now in APT 3.0. It's much more polished than before and all around looking great.

  3. #APT3.0 #Paketmanager erschienen – das ist neu - #fosstopia:

    Die #Linux-Welt verzeichnet einen bedeutenden Schritt: Der beliebte Paketmanager #APT geht in Version 3.0 an den Start. Die Veröffentlichung markiert den Beginn einer neuen stabilen Serie, gewidmet Steve Langasek, einem prägenden Mitgestalter von #Debian und #Ubuntu, der am 1. Januar 2025 verstarb.

  4. #APT3.0 ist da! -

    Ein Jahr ist es her, dass #Debian mit APT 2.9 mit mehr Farbe und gegliederter Darstellung für eine bessere Übersicht in #Debians #Paketmanager-Frontend sorgte. Einen Monat später stellte Debian- und Ubuntu-Entwickler Julian Andres Klode mit APT 2.9.3 einen neuen Solver vor.
